Percier, Charles (1764-1838)
Crowd in Front of the Tuileries Palace During the Wedding of Napoleon to Marie-Louise of Austria, ca. 1810. Pen and gray ink, brush and gray wash, over black chalk, 16 3/8 x 12 1/8 in. (41.6 x 30.8 cm). Purchase, Harris Brisbane Dick Fund and Joseph Pulitzer Bequest, 1971 (1971.513.25).
